У нас есть HP Proliant DL320e под управлением CentOS 6.
Мы получим жесткие диски SATA с данными в форматах NTFS, FAT, HFS и HFS +, с которых мы хотели бы копировать файлы на сервер (только для чтения), желательно без необходимости перезагружать сервер каждый раз.
Итак, какой-то поставщик данных пришлет нам жесткий диск, мы подключим его к серверу, прочитаем данные, отключим жесткий диск и вернем жесткий диск по почте. На каждом диске будет несколько терабайт данных. Мы просто скопируем его, используя cp -R
или что-то подобное. В настоящее время мы предполагаем, что поставщики не будут отправлять нам вредоносные данные. Данные будут записаны в систему Synology RAID, которая сможет записывать данные намного быстрее, чем мы можем прочитать их с одного жесткого диска.
У нас есть RAID-контроллер HP «B120i» с несколькими свободными слотами, но, вероятно, мы не можем использовать его для чтения дисков без рейдов, присланных нам клиентами, верно?
Кроме того, у нас есть внутренний разъем SATA, который продавец намеревался использовать, чтобы продать нам дорогой DVD-ридер. Мы не покупали его, чтобы разъем SATA был свободным.
Теперь продавец сообщает нам, что к внутреннему разъему SATA нельзя подключить ничего, кроме DVD-плеера, и что лучшим вариантом будет подключение жестких дисков через USB. Такое ощущение, что USB будет медленнее SATA.
Можно ли использовать внутренний разъем SATA, возможно, с удлинителем?
Потребуются ли нам какие-то специальные драйверы, которых нет в CentOS, если мы не подключим диски через USB?
Как лучше всего передать данные на сервер?
Хотя я безмерно обожаю контроллеры HP SmartArray в данном конкретном случае, вам нужно избегать их, вам нужен какой-то «тупой» контроллер, который ничего не делает, кроме доступа к диску в BIOS. Затем вы можете подключить его, возможно, через eSATA, к внешнему корпусу. Убедитесь, что они оба поддерживают горячее подключение, и все готово. Вы могли бы использовать USB, но я бы сам хотел придерживаться eSATA, меньше переводов, и это должно быть намного быстрее.
Контроллер HP Smart Array RAID в этой системе не будет вам здесь полезен, главным образом потому, что он использует проприетарный формат RAID на диске. Вы не сможете читать необработанные диски, которые вы получаете с помощью HP Smart Array на сервере.
Вы должны использовать док-станция для судебной экспертизы и соответствующий интерфейс на вашем сервере (у вас есть USB 3.0 на сервере). Для этого не нужно прикасаться к внутренним компонентам сервера, особенно если вам требуется только читать доступ.
Я бы подключил диски к другому хосту unix / linux и смонтировал его там, а затем использовал бы rsync для копирования с внешних дисков. По крайней мере, в этом случае никто не меняет конфигурацию рабочего сервера.